Port Isaac is known for its charming atmosphere, famously featured in the TV series "Doc Martin," and offers an array of shops, pubs, and restaurants within walking distance. Nearby attractions include the stunning sandy beaches of Polzeath and Daymer Bay, as well as the vibrant town of Padstow, home to Rick Stein's renowned fish restaurant. Guests can also explore the scenic Camel Trail, which is perfect for walking or cycling along the estuary to Wadebridge and beyond.
